Einav Yogev is a strategic consultant in the fields civil society, security and leadership development. She previously worked as a researcher at the Institute for National Security Studies (INSS) in the institute’s terrorism and low intensity war program, and as a researcher in the program researching Delegitimisation and BDS. 


In 2010 Einav initiated and created an internship program within the terrorism and low intensity war program which has become a flagship program for the INSS and a source of requiting applicants various security organizations and government offices. 


Einav has vast experience in leading, planning and managing social entrepreneurship within leading international NGOs, such as Oxfam and Amnesty International. 


She is a Volunteer in the “Common Ground” organisation which promotes women and gender equality education. She has an MA with honours in Policy from Georgetown University, an MA in Diplomacy and a BA in Philosophy and English Literature English, both From Tel Aviv University.
